    Abstract: In the field of transport paths used typically in postage meters, it is sometimes desired to prevent withdrawal of items in the opposite direction to forward travel along the transport path. The disclosure relates to a one way gate (10) for such a transport path including a transport surface (11). The gate includes a rotatable roller (17) disposed opposite the surface such that an item traveling forwardly along the transport path engages and rotates the roller (17); and a device preventing rotation of the roller (17) in a direction corresponding to withdrawal of an item (22) in a reverse direction along the transport path.

    Abstract: A web engagement system for an off-reel printing press comprising a guide piece, a guide channel and drive stations for the displacement of the guide piece. The guide channel accommodates and guides the guide piece and is located on the frame of the press between the drive stations. The guide piece is slightly longer than the distance separating the various drive stations. The advance of the guide piece is caused as a result of the displacement of a slide equipped with wedging rollers which alternately grip and release the guide piece. A pair of wedging rollers prevents the return movement of the guide piece. The invention is used for introducing paper webs unwinding continuously in an off-reel printing press.

    Abstract: A hitch feed assembly for automatically aligning individual lead frames at a bonding site in both the longitudinal and lateral directions is disclosed. The alignment is attained as a result of the cooperation between a plurality of chamfered pawls and the sprocket holes in the film-carrier. The pawls are chamfered along three sides in order to attain alignment in both the longitudinal and lateral directions. Significantly, the pawls come into operational contact with the sprocket holes while the lead frame film-carrier is under minimal tension so that the pressure exerted on the edges of the sprocket holes by the pawls will be minimal, thereby avoiding any deformation in the shape of the sprocket holes.

    Abstract: A fastener feed assembly for a tool such as a power screwdriver having a drive member such as a rotatable bit includes a base fixed to the tool and a nose assembly slidably related to the base. The nose assembly includes a workpiece engaging surface, and when the tool is moved toward the workpiece during a fastener driving operation, the base moves toward the nose assembly. A return spring separates the base and nose assembly when the tool is withdrawn away from the workpiece. A strip of fasteners is fed from a magazine along a feed path through the nose assembly with sequential fasteners located in a drive position. Normally the drive member is spaced from a fastener in the drive position. During movement of the tool toward the workpiece in a driving operation, the drive member moves into engagement with a fastener in the drive position, and then continues to move in order to drive the fastener into the workpiece. A pawl is engageable with the strip in order to advance the strip along the feed path.
